The First Born


Director: Miles Mander

Genre: Drama

Year: 1928

Running time: 86 minutes

Territory: Worldwide

Studio: ITV

Cast: Miles Mander, Madeleine Carroll, John Loder

The First Born, adapted by Miles Mander from his own novel and play, deals with difficult subjects - the double standards of the upper classes, jealousy and secrecy, miscegenation, and the tension between conformity and a more modern morality. Sewn into the plot are also references to the world of politics, of which Mander had much experience, as the younger brother of Sir Geoffrey Mander, the eminent Liberal radical.
